Appearance
Lughon manifests as a man of indeterminate age with skin the color of polished mahogany and hair like spun silver thread that glows faintly in low light. His eyes are his most striking feature, appearing as liquid gold when he is pleased and shifting to cold, sharp obsidian when he is offended. He moves with a rhythmic, liquid grace that makes him appear to be dancing even when standing still. Unexpectedly, despite his divine status, his hands are heavily calloused and stained with various dyes and oils, looking more like those of a struggling blacksmith than a deity.
